A challenging problem in the topic of the nonlinear dynamics of the magnetosphere is the physical process responsible for the onset of magnetospheric substorms. The early collaboration with Dr. K. Papadopoulos has led to the proposal of a kinetic plasma instability, called the cross-field current instability, as the onset process. This has developed into a full-blown research effort, supplementing the initial theoretical analysis with in-depth data analysis and particle simulations. Several theoretical predictions based on this instability are successfully verified in observations. Data from the present NASA THEMIS mission provide some evidence for its validity. Further investigations for this substorm onset process are also discussed.
